A constructive approach for the treatment of Stummel's examples to the patch test is presented, together with generalizations of these examples. The strange convergence phenomenon of nonconforming approximations is discussed in detail, and a kind of modified variational equation for remedying these defects is introduced. Our variational equation uses a combination of hybrid and penalty methods that define a convergent procedure with optimal order of convergence to the exact solution with respect to a mesh‐dependent norm.
